1,759,741,765,767,659,520 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 1759741765767659520 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 6 prime factors (large circles) and 11250 divisors.

1759741765767659520 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eleven thousand, two hundred fifty divisors.

Prime factorization of 1759741765767659520:

224 × 34 × 5 × 72 × 114 × 192

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 19 × 19)

Names of 1759741765767659520

  • Cardinal: 1759741765767659520 can be written as One quintillion, seven hundred fifty-nine quadrillion, seven hundred forty-one trillion, seven hundred sixty-five billion, seven hundred sixty-seven million, six hundred fifty-nine thousand, five hundred twenty.

Scientific notation

  • Scientific notation: 1.75974176576765952 × 1018

Factors of 1759741765767659520

  • Number of distinct prime factors ω(n): 6
  • Total number of prime factors Ω(n): 37
  • Sum of prime factors: 47

Bases of 1759741765767659520

  • Binary: 11000011010111101101111001111111111010000000000000000000000002
  • Hexadecimal: 0x186BDBCFFD000000
  • Base-36: DDB4E6WO3K00

Squares and roots of 1759741765767659520

  • 1759741765767659520 squared (17597417657676595202) is 3096691082187080262877006738646630400
  • 1759741765767659520 cubed (17597417657676595203) is 5449376633004857071731862400984551903424893742481408000
  • The square root of 1759741765767659520 is 1326552586.8836333169
  • The cube root of 1759741765767659520 is 1207303.0948051491
